Position Summary: Lifesaving & Care Specialists are responsible for the daily functions, and growth of lifesaving programs including adoption, foster care, transfer/transport, as well as providing basic animal care for animals in our program locations. Specialists act with urgency to accomplish important tasks and play a direct role in achieving Best Friends Animal Society’s no-kill mission and organizational success. Specialists may receive intensive assignments in a particular program, based on organizational needs. Senior specialists have an increased level of responsibility or skills, and the ability to make on-the-spot decisions to accomplish tasks.
